Kindeva Drug Delivery Careers is Hiring a Controls Specialist Near Los Angeles, CA

Kindeva Drug Delivery
Kindeva is a leading global contract developer and manufacturer (CDMO) with delivery platform expertise in Autoinjector, Inhalation, Transdermal/Intradermal Patch Technologies. We partner with our customers to improve patient outcomes around the world. Together, as One Team, we will manufacture many more tomorrows.
ROLE SUMMARY
​​​We are seeking an experienced Controls Specialist to join our dynamic team focused on Inhalation and Transdermal Drug Delivery Manufacturing. The successful candidate will play a crucial role in Controls and Automation department, supporting high-speed automation lines, ensuring efficient production processes, contributing to the success of capital projects and improvements to existing manufacturing lines.​​​​
ROLE RESPONSIBILITIES
  • ​​As a Controls Specialist Working with Controls and Automation department, you will be instrumental in troubleshooting and solving Controls and Automation equipment issues.
  • ​Works with Manufacturing, Maintenance and Process Engineering in implementing Capital Equipment installation or Existing equipment improvement projects.
  • ​This role services requests and provides support to all production and maintenance related functions along with electrical and process control troubleshooting.
  • ​Diagnosing and communicating problems, root causes and short/long term solutions!
  • ​Program, service, repair, and maintain instrumentation, electrical, and process controls.
  • ​Repairs primary sensing elements, control circuitry and final control devices used in closed and open loop industrial process control systems.
  • ​Troubleshoots and diagnoses equipment malfunctions and makes repairs or adjustments to Automated equipment.​
BASIC QUALIFICATIONS
  • ​​Bachelor’s degree in mechanical, Systems/Electrical/Electronics, Biomedical Engineering or equivalent from an accredited University
  • ​5 years of experience in manufacturing high speed automation/ equipment design and/or maintenance with troubleshooting experience in a regulated industry.
  • ​Experience working with and programming Programmable Logic Controllers (PLCs) and Human Machine Interfaces (HMIs)
  • ​Basic troubleshooting of PCBA and repair experience
  • ​Proven experience operating DMM, clamp on ammeter and Oscilloscope
  • ​Solid interpersonal and communication skills, both written & oral.
  • ​Ability to read electrical schematics, Pneumatic/Mechanical drawings.
  • ​Extensive experience in implementing process improvements on high-speed automated manufacturing equipment to drive operating efficiencies.
  • ​Solid understanding and ability to tackle electrical circuits and motors up to and including 480 volts.
  • ​Follow all standard work procedures, safety regulations, and policies to maintain safe working environment.
  • ​Troubleshoot equipment problems to reduce productivity losses and implement long term corrective actions to avoid reoccurrence.
  • ​Experience or Knowledge with Vision Systems (Cognex, Keyence)
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
  • ​​Prior experience in a Medical Device or Pharmaceutical Industry and background in process automation.
  • Prior experience in New Product Introduction activities
  • Experience or knowledge of 21 CFR -Parts 210 and 211 (FDA)
  • Experience of Pharmaceutical Serialization.
  • Experience or Knowledge of Optel Serialization systems
  • Experience in CAD software like Solidworks
  • Hands on experience or knowledge of Machine shop equipment, Mill and Lathe.​​
